Output cadec843a72ebb6ea9754ae2031c66b5aec879f5f2ace10f8fe42e5fd024e8b6:5

value
3440166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d24c0f2330ba653e6262f2414a45884b49b76a7 OP_EQUAL
address
3LPiUZTtbon2YNxW3ZXxCtGGQacMYfdvuM
transaction
cadec843a72ebb6ea9754ae2031c66b5aec879f5f2ace10f8fe42e5fd024e8b6
confirmations
121606
spent
true